Nesta dissertação é estudado um importante tópico concernente às redes totalmente ópticas: algoritmos de roteamento e atribuição de comprimentos de onda (RWA). Nas redes totalmente ópticas, o sinal óptico não é regenerado a cada nó. Por isso, é muito importante o desenvolvimento de algoritmos de RWA capazes de encontrar rotas levando em consideração a degradação do sinal óptico, ou seja, algoritmos de IRWA (Impairment Aware Routing and Wavelength Assignment). Neste trabalho são propostas duas novas abordagens para solução do RWA em redes totalmente ópticas. Ambas utilizam parâmetros de redes simples, como comprimento e ocupação de enlace, para montagem de algoritmos de roteamento adaptativos de alto desempenho em ambientes de rede ópticas limitadas pelas penalidades da camada física. Por essa razão, os algoritmos aqui propostos conseguem resolver o problema de IRWA de forma rápida. Na primeira abordagem, denominada PIAWF (Physical Impairment Aware Weight Function), é definida uma nova função custo adaptativa para enlaces que possui dois parâmetros livres, nos quais são armazenados, de forma indireta, informações sobre as penalidades da camada física. Na segunda abordagem, denominada roteamento por série de potência, é elaborada uma forma sistemática de se construir funções de custo adaptativas a partir de parâmetros pré-estabelecidos por um especialista em redes. Estes parâmetros são as variáveis da função custo, a qual é expandida em uma série de potências multivariável. Os coeficientes desconhecidos da série devem ser otimizados com o objetivo de melhorar o desempenho de rede. A técnica Particle Swarm Optimization é utilizada para encontrar os coeficientes da série

Der volle Inhalt der QuelleThe Swedish military doctrine stresses six basic capabilities for analysing the opponent. These six capabilities are defined as command, endurance, intelligence and information, mobility, effect and defence. It is a given model designed to gain maximum effect through action and the capabilities are always present in the battlefield. They affect one another and their importance varies over time. The aim of this essay is to highlight the IRA progress during 1968-74 from the capability perspective. The study shows a significant increase in IRA’s ability to use arms and in the area of bomb strategy development. The progress concerning the other five capabilities’ turned out to be of lesser significance. A reason for this could be that the study focuses on the very beginning of the troubles and the IRA’s growth into becoming a non-state armed actor.
